員工管理系統(tǒng)設(shè)計報告參考模板_第1頁
員工管理系統(tǒng)設(shè)計報告參考模板_第2頁
員工管理系統(tǒng)設(shè)計報告參考模板_第3頁
員工管理系統(tǒng)設(shè)計報告參考模板_第4頁
員工管理系統(tǒng)設(shè)計報告參考模板_第5頁
已閱讀5頁,還剩19頁未讀 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認(rèn)領(lǐng)

文檔簡介

員工管理系統(tǒng)設(shè)計報告告、員工管理系統(tǒng)實現(xiàn)文檔、員工管理系統(tǒng)測試報告一套項目開發(fā)文檔,適用于畢業(yè)設(shè)計論文參考員工管理系統(tǒng)設(shè)計報告 二、基本設(shè)計概念和處理流程 三、系統(tǒng)數(shù)據(jù)庫設(shè)計 員工管理系統(tǒng)設(shè)計報告導(dǎo)系統(tǒng)實現(xiàn)以及編碼。本文檔作為員工管理系統(tǒng)的設(shè)計說明文檔,用于與用戶確定最終的目標(biāo),并成為協(xié)議文本的一部分,同時也是本系統(tǒng)設(shè)計人員的基礎(chǔ)2.組成部分對該系統(tǒng)進行詳細(xì)的設(shè)計。第一部分是對系統(tǒng)功能和業(yè)務(wù)流程進行了仔細(xì)的分析和簡單介紹了其實現(xiàn)方法。該部分主要包括系統(tǒng)整體功能設(shè)計、登錄流程的設(shè)計和實現(xiàn)、公司基本信息處理流程設(shè)計、簽到流程的設(shè)計和實現(xiàn)、請假流程的設(shè)計和實現(xiàn)、發(fā)布公告流程的設(shè)計和實現(xiàn)和留言流程的設(shè)計和實現(xiàn)七大模塊,每模塊都對各自功能實現(xiàn)做了詳細(xì)介紹為后來的項目實現(xiàn)打下良好基礎(chǔ)。第二部分對數(shù)據(jù)庫表的設(shè)計做了簡單介紹并將每張表的數(shù)據(jù)字典羅列出來。該部分主要包括用戶表的設(shè)計和數(shù)據(jù)字典、員工表的設(shè)計和數(shù)據(jù)字典、請假表的設(shè)計和數(shù)據(jù)字典、部門表的設(shè)計和數(shù)據(jù)字典、職位表的設(shè)計和數(shù)據(jù)字典、留言表的設(shè)計和數(shù)據(jù)字典、公告表的設(shè)計和數(shù)據(jù)字典和簽到表的設(shè)計和數(shù)據(jù)字典八大模塊,各模塊對應(yīng)數(shù)據(jù)庫中不同的數(shù)據(jù)表格,為數(shù)據(jù)庫表的創(chuàng)建打下良好基礎(chǔ)。員工管理系統(tǒng)設(shè)計報告二、基本設(shè)計概念和處理流程員工管理系統(tǒng)主要分為登錄、公司基本信息管理、員工請假與考勤管理、公司公告管理、公司留言管理、公司通訊錄、回收站七個模塊。系統(tǒng)主模塊功部門管理公司基本信息管理職位管理用戶管理簽到管理請假管理提交公告公告審核公告查看新增留言通訊錄員工刪除歷史部門刪除歷史職位刪除歷史用戶刪除歷史請假與考勤管理員工管理系公告管理在瀏覽器輸入地址訪問本系統(tǒng)時,會有過濾器控制進入登錄頁面,在登錄頁面員工管理系統(tǒng)設(shè)計報告輸入姓名和密碼經(jīng)過校驗后會進入系統(tǒng)主頁,主頁可以根據(jù)不同的用戶權(quán)限自動控制當(dāng)前登錄人可以操作的界面,并展現(xiàn)出來,該操作涉及到的數(shù)據(jù)庫表主要是用戶表和員工表。登錄流程圖如圖2-2所示。員工管理系統(tǒng)設(shè)計報告驗證用戶姓名和密碼YY管理員權(quán)限錯誤提示超級管理員權(quán)限員工操作界面驗證員工姓名和密碼作界面超級管理驗證管理NN公司基本信息管理是本系統(tǒng)主要功能點之一,在本模塊可以完成對公司所有員工、部門、職位和用戶的所有信息進行操作,操作涉及到的數(shù)據(jù)庫表主要有員工表、部門表、職位表和用戶表。對員工信息表的主要功能操作有新入職員工信息的錄入,涉及到存入數(shù)據(jù)庫的字段有員工編號、姓名、性別、出生日期、學(xué)歷、手機、郵箱、住址、部門、職位、入職日期、薪水、愛好創(chuàng)建時間和最后修改時間。員工信息維護是對除員工姓名之外的所有信息的修改和刪除操作,在員工查詢中將員工姓名、員工所在部門、員工創(chuàng)建時間和員工最后操作時間作為檢索字段,在員工信息加載時可以將這幾個字段作為查詢條件添加到檢索語句中從而達(dá)到精確查找的效果。對部門信息表的操作同樣包含新部門的創(chuàng)建,入庫的字段主要有部門編號、部門名稱、創(chuàng)建時間和最后修改時間。部門信息的維護即為對所有已入庫的部門進行修改和刪除操作,部門查詢中以部門名稱、創(chuàng)建時間和最后修改時間作為檢索字段,在加載部門信息的同時將這幾個字段作為查詢條件添加到查詢語句中可以滿足對部門精確查找的需求。對所有已存員工管理系統(tǒng)設(shè)計報告職位名稱、所在部門、管理人、創(chuàng)建時間和最后修改時間。對所有已入庫的職位可以進行修改、刪除和檢索操作,檢索字段有職位名稱、所在部門、創(chuàng)建時間和最后修改時間,在加載職位數(shù)據(jù)的同時將這幾個字段添加到查詢語句中以達(dá)到精確查找的目的。對用戶表的操作主要有新用戶的增加,涉及到的字段有用戶編號、用戶密碼、用戶名稱、創(chuàng)建時間、最后修改時間和用戶權(quán)限。對用戶表已存在數(shù)據(jù)可以執(zhí)行修改、刪除和查詢操作,查詢條件有用戶名稱、創(chuàng)建時間、用戶權(quán)限和最后修改時間,在頁面加載用戶數(shù)據(jù)的同時將這幾個檢索條件合并到查詢語句中以達(dá)到檢索要求。相應(yīng)操作對應(yīng)的數(shù)據(jù)庫表的關(guān)員工管理系統(tǒng)設(shè)計報告公司基本信息管理公司基本信息管理超級管理員和管理員超級管理員超級管理員超級管理員用戶管理用戶數(shù)據(jù)庫職位數(shù)據(jù)庫部門數(shù)據(jù)庫員工數(shù)據(jù)庫職位管理部門管理4.簽到流程的設(shè)計和實現(xiàn)的簽到、簽退以及公司領(lǐng)導(dǎo)對員工日??记谛畔z索查看的功能需求。該模塊操作涉及到的數(shù)據(jù)庫表主要是簽到表,其中字段主要有簽到記錄編號、簽到員工編號、簽到時間、簽退時間和簽到狀態(tài)。功能實現(xiàn)流程圖如圖2-4所示。員工管理系統(tǒng)設(shè)計報告N是否已經(jīng)簽到NY是否已超過上班時間NN正常簽到Y(jié)簽退成功是否已經(jīng)簽到是否已經(jīng)簽到遲到或曠工錯誤提示YY請假流程是根據(jù)公司需求而設(shè)計的功能模塊,對于一個公司來說請假往往是比較頻繁的操作流程,以往的填寫紙質(zhì)的請假條并找上級簽字的形式繁瑣而又比較麻煩,已經(jīng)滿足不了現(xiàn)代公司發(fā)展的需求。本系統(tǒng)的請假流程操作只需要員工提交請假電子信息到上級管理人員,經(jīng)上級人員批準(zhǔn)后即可完成請假操作方便而又快捷。該流程涉及到的數(shù)據(jù)庫表主要是請假表,字段值有請假編號、請假人編號、提交人編號請假原因、請假開始時間、請假結(jié)束時間、批準(zhǔn)時間、銷假時間、提交時間、備注和請假流程狀態(tài)。對該表信息的維護只有處于未提交狀態(tài)下的請假信息可以修改以及處于未提交和已銷假的請假信息可以執(zhí)行刪當(dāng)前用戶的請假記錄中處于待審核狀態(tài)下的記錄信息,并且只可以執(zhí)行審批通過和審批不通過操作不可以執(zhí)行刪除操作;擁有超級管理員權(quán)限的用戶可以查看和審批所有員工的請假記錄并可以對已經(jīng)銷假的記錄執(zhí)行刪除操作。請假流員工管理系統(tǒng)設(shè)計報告請假人編號、請假開始時間、請假結(jié)束時間、請假請假記錄編號、請假開始時間、請假結(jié)束時間、請請假記錄編號、請假記錄所處狀態(tài)、提交時間請假記錄編號、請假記錄所處狀態(tài)、審批時間發(fā)布公告流程功能用到的數(shù)據(jù)庫表主要是公告表,主要字段有公告編號、創(chuàng)建人編號、公告標(biāo)題、公告內(nèi)容、公告創(chuàng)建時間和公告最后修改時間。在本操作中由擁有管理員權(quán)限的用戶進行公告的編寫并提交給超級管理員進行審批,未提交的公告可以進行修改和刪除。提交后的公告不可以修改和刪除,經(jīng)過超級管理員的審批后可以發(fā)布,審批不通過的公告會返回管理員提交公告的列表中,管理員可以對其撤回重新編寫或者刪除。發(fā)布后的公告所有公司內(nèi)部員工都可以查看,便于內(nèi)部員工獲取公司新的消息和通知。留言流程功能操作對應(yīng)數(shù)據(jù)庫留言表的操作,主要字段有留言編號、留言內(nèi)容、回復(fù)內(nèi)容、創(chuàng)建人、回復(fù)人編號、創(chuàng)建時間、回復(fù)時間、狀態(tài)標(biāo)識。留言流程的發(fā)起人是公司內(nèi)部所有員工,員工可以將想要反饋給公司的消息以留復(fù)消息。員工發(fā)送給管理層人員的留言以未回復(fù)的狀態(tài)顯示在員工和管理層人情。經(jīng)管理層人員回復(fù)后的留言以已回復(fù)的狀態(tài)顯示,該狀態(tài)可以執(zhí)行刪除操員工管理系統(tǒng)設(shè)計報告三、系統(tǒng)數(shù)據(jù)庫設(shè)計的操作都關(guān)聯(lián)本表的增刪改查。添加新用戶會將表現(xiàn)層中用戶操作時填寫的新用戶的所有數(shù)據(jù)傳到控制層,控制層接收數(shù)據(jù)并傳輸給邏輯層,邏輯層裝換判的各字段中,從而產(chǎn)生一條新數(shù)據(jù),標(biāo)示新用戶的添加功能操作成功。頁面會將操作成功后的成功提示展現(xiàn)給用戶以便于用戶了解當(dāng)前操作的成功狀態(tài)。刪除用戶操作時表現(xiàn)層會將用戶操作的數(shù)據(jù)編號傳給控制層,經(jīng)過邏輯層最后傳錄從表中刪除,從而完成刪除用戶的操作。刪除成功后表現(xiàn)層給用戶反饋刪除成功消息。編輯操作表現(xiàn)層會將用戶操作的記錄編號和修改信息傳到控制層,經(jīng)過邏輯層的處理后傳給Dao層,Dao層利用修改sql命令將數(shù)據(jù)庫中用戶表主鍵為接收到的記錄編號的記錄信息用接收的用的信息替代從而完成修改操作,操作成功后反饋給用戶操作成功信息。查詢操作時Dao層利用檢索語句將數(shù)據(jù)庫表中的數(shù)據(jù)檢索出來并利用表現(xiàn)層展現(xiàn)給用戶。用戶表的數(shù)據(jù)字典如表3-1控制管理員和超級管理員createtimedatatime創(chuàng)建時間notnull員工管理系統(tǒng)設(shè)計報告員工管理系統(tǒng)設(shè)計報告本系統(tǒng)中數(shù)據(jù)交換最頻繁,數(shù)據(jù)量最大的數(shù)據(jù)表。員工信息的操作往往是公司內(nèi)部一項重要的操作功能,因為員工是組成一個公司的最重要的成員,所以對員工的操作應(yīng)是謹(jǐn)慎而又嚴(yán)密性的。員工表的設(shè)計業(yè)應(yīng)該體現(xiàn)出該特點,在員工表的設(shè)計中加入職位表和部門表的外鍵從而方便員工信息和部門信息以及職位信息的統(tǒng)一操作,減少了員工信息操作時對部門表和職位表的信息變動操作。員工信息表的數(shù)據(jù)字典如表3-2所示。員工部門名稱檢索字段pcreatetimedatatime員工創(chuàng)建時間notnull記錄創(chuàng)建時間plastchangetimedatatime員工最后修改時間notnull記錄最后操作員工管理系統(tǒng)設(shè)計報告員工部門名稱檢索字段pcreatetimedatatime員工創(chuàng)建時間notnull記錄創(chuàng)建時間plastchangetimedatatime員工最后修改時間notnull記錄最后操作status假等各個流程中,請假信息在數(shù)據(jù)庫表中的狀態(tài)值改變和信息值的改變能夠?qū)嶋H的反應(yīng)在表現(xiàn)層中,以供員工和用戶的查看和操作。請假信息表的數(shù)據(jù)字典員工管理系統(tǒng)設(shè)計報告4.部門表的設(shè)計和數(shù)據(jù)字典作都涉及到本表的增刪改查操作。用戶執(zhí)行部門增加功能時對數(shù)據(jù)庫中該表會執(zhí)行插入記錄操作,如果插入成功則標(biāo)志部門增加成功。用戶執(zhí)行修改功能操作時會對數(shù)據(jù)庫部門表執(zhí)行更新記錄操作,表內(nèi)數(shù)據(jù)更新成功則表示修改部門操作成功。用戶執(zhí)行刪除部門操作時,會對該表執(zhí)行刪除記錄操作,如果該表成功移除記錄則表示刪除部門操作成功。對表格記錄的查詢功能是在表現(xiàn)層加載部門列表的時候執(zhí)行,查詢語句會將部門表中的所有滿足條件的數(shù)據(jù)檢索出員工管理系統(tǒng)設(shè)計報告所有操作都是基于本表的增刪改查基礎(chǔ)上的,對該表所有記錄的操作狀態(tài)都會在表現(xiàn)層以不同形式的提示信息展現(xiàn)給用戶,便于用戶了解當(dāng)前的操作的是否成功。職位表的數(shù)據(jù)字典如表3-5所示。員工管理系統(tǒng)設(shè)計報告所有操作都是基于本表的增刪改查基礎(chǔ)上的,在展現(xiàn)層上當(dāng)前員工只能看到創(chuàng)建人字段中為本人的留言記錄,而所有管理員和超級管理員可以看到所有狀態(tài)為未回復(fù)的留言記錄。該表對所有記錄的操作狀態(tài)都會在表現(xiàn)層以不同形式的提示信息展現(xiàn)給不同用戶,便于業(yè)務(wù)流程的實現(xiàn)以及便于用戶了解當(dāng)前的操作的是否成功等。留言表的數(shù)據(jù)字典如表3-6所示。所有操作都是基于本表的增刪改查基礎(chǔ)上的。在展現(xiàn)層管理員只能看到創(chuàng)建人為本人的公告記錄,超級管理員可以看到所有狀態(tài)為未審核的公告記錄。對公告操作的業(yè)務(wù)流程等

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論